Born in Korea and based in Naarm(Melbourne), Yoony Yoony explores themes of freedom, adversity, and empathy through contemporary interpretations of Korean traditional painting. Her practice began with reflections on her family’s experiences and Korean history but has since expanded to embrace stories of resilience and care shared across the world. Painting inspiration from nature and its quiet strength, she expresses the desire for peace, dignity, and harmony within human life.
